Containing suggestions and methods for overcoming male plant sterility, inbreeding, and challenges to pollination, this book can help you successfully breed hybrid plants to produce bountiful and healthy crops. It provides research about heterosis, cultivars, hybrids, and molecular markers to help you get the most out of your seeds.
